I already posted about USMNT eligible Shawn Parker’s day, but quite a few guys in action on Tuesday, including another start for Bobby Wood with 1860 Munich’s senior team.
Steve Cherundolo (Hannover 96 – German Bundesliga) – Steve got the start and went the full 90 minutes in Hannover 96′s 2-0 victory over Greuther Fürth.
Brad Guzan (Aston Villa – English Premier League) – Brad got the start and went the full 90 minutes in Aston Villa’s 1-0 victory over Reading.
Jermaine Jones (FC Schalke – German Bundesliga) – Jermaine got the start and went the full 90 minutes in FC Schalke’s 3-1 loss to Hamburg.
Sacha Kljestan (Anderlecht – Belgian First Division) – Sacha got the start and went the full 120 minutes in Anderlecht’s 2-0 victory over Mechelen in the Belgian Cup.
Eric Lichaj (Aston Villa – English Premier League) – Eric came off the bench and played 66 minutes in Aston Villa’s 1-0 victory over Reading.
Oguchi Onyewu (Malaga – Spanish La Liga) – Oguchi got the start and went the full 90 minutes in Malaga’s 1-0 loss to Cacereño in the Copa del Rey.
Jonathan Spector (Birmingham City – English League Championship) – Jonathan got the start and went the full 90 minutes in Birmingham City’s 1-1 draw to Blackpool.
Zak Whitbread (Leicester City – English League Championship) – Zak got the start and went the full 90 minutes in Leicester City’s 1-0 loss to Leeds United.
Bobby Wood (1860 Muinch – German 2. Bundesliga) – Bobby got the start and went the full 90 minutes in 1860 Munich’s 1-0 victory over Paderborn.
